This article will look at the Kenya Institute of Special Education (KISE) certificate in sign language fees structure. KISE is a semi-autonomous agency of the Ministry of Education. It is located off Kasarani -Mwiki Road in Nairobi.
Kenya Institute of Special Education is one of the best sign language schools in Kenya. It has been offering training since 1986. The school offers a Certificate in Kenyan Sign Language (KSL) in full-time, distance learning, and evening class modes.
Course Duration: 3 months.
Requirements for Admission
A minimum KCSE grade of D+ or its equivalent.
Kenya Institute of Special Education Certificate In Sign Language Fees Structure
Fees | |
Registration | Ksh 5,000 |
Tuition | Ksh 52,500 |
Administrative cost | Ksh 9,000 |
Total | Ksh 66,500 |
-Limited accommodation and meals are available at Ksh 19,000.
b) Certificate in Kenya Sign Language (KSL) through Distance Learning Mode for students with a diploma in SNE ( IE Option)
This is a certificate course for a diploma in SNE ( inclusive education ). Graduands are exempted from KSL session 1.
Fees | |
Registration | Ksh 2,500 |
Tuition | Ksh 36,830 |
Administrative cost | Ksh 5,000 |
Total | Ksh 44, 330 |
Please note that the fees are subject to change. Contact the school using the avenues below for fee policies and payments.
